Texas Public Radio: The San Antonio Symphony brings music and memories to those with dementia

The San Antonio Symphony performed Hollywood hits for people with dementia and their caregivers.

The performance was part of the Memory and Music program at the Glenn Biggs Institute for Alzheimer’s and Neurodegenerative Diseases.

San Antonio Symphony and the Tobin Center welcome those with dementia and their caregivers to certain rehearsals so they can enjoy the music in an environment more suited to their needs.
